Deutsche Trader Denies Knowing About Euribor Rig At Trial

By Paige Long (June 6, 2018, 7:20 PM BST) -- A Deutsche Bank AG trader fighting Euribor rigging charges told a London court on Wednesday that he did not know his more junior colleagues were regularly relaying requests over chat and email to move the key interest rate in favorable directions, though when he did overhear one suspect exchange he didn't think "that much" of it....
